United States Air Force (USAF) aircraft parts forecasting techniques have remained archaic despite new advancements in data analysis. This approach resulted in a 57% accuracy rate in fiscal year 2016 for USAF managed items. Those errors combine for $5.5 billion worth of inventory that could have been spent on other critical spare parts. This research effort explores advancements in condition based maintenance (CBM) and its application in the realm of forecasting. A Mobility Readiness Spares Package (MRSP) is an air-transportable package of spare parts configured for rapid deployment in support of conflict or war. Each package is tailored to support a specific scenario, for a specific type and number of aircraft without re-supply for the first 30 days of deployment. Inventory is limited to mission-critical spares. The high cost of airlift and spares drive a necessity to keep MRSPs as small as possible, yet robust enough to meet wartime goals. Traditionally, logistics analysts have treated the delivery problem separate from the inventory and repair problems. In other words, each of these three problems-delivery, inventory, and repair-are treated individually. We combine the vehicle routing problems and inventory allocation problems in a single formulation. Furthermore, lateral re-supply is considered, in that supplies are not only available from the main depot, but also from other bases. After we get the lateral re-supply information, we set a delivery allocation plan out of the main depot. Such allocations are then delivered via vehicles stationed at the main depot. Current Foreign Military Sales FMS models provide stock levels that result in a very low system availability or a funding requirement that exceeds the overall budget. The purpose of this research was to determine if an inventory model exists that can be used in FMS reparable sparing to provide a more efficient and economical inventory purchase. The Aircraft Sustainability Model ASM is such a model, providing the most aircraft availability possible from a given inventory investment by computing the optimal number of spare parts to buy for each item.
